Characteristics of solc filters in chi((2)) nonlinear photonic crystals
- Abstract
- The characteristics of Solc filters in chi((2)) nonlinear photonic crystals, periodically poled lithium niobate (LiNbO3), were investigated by the Jones matrix method. The transmittance increases and the full width half maximum of the filter becomes narrow as the duty ratio increases. However, the filtering wavelength does not change. The transmittance at the filtering wavelength is over 95% when the duty ratio is larger than 0.35.
